Position Summary: 

We are seeking an experienced and dynamic Product Manager to join our team. The ideal candidate will have a strong background in technology product management, preferably within a Software as a Service (SaaS) company, and possess extensive experience in US healthcare analytics, business intelligence, data modeling/normalization and AI/ML solutions. This role requires a strategic thinker with an understanding of Agile methodology and the Software Development Lifecycle (SDLC).


Key Relationships: Engineering, Customer Experience, Product, Sales

 

Key Accountabilities:  

  • Lead the end-to-end product lifecycle from ideation to launch, ensuring alignment with business goals and customer needs. 
  • Collaborate with cross-functional teams, including engineering, design, marketing, and sales, to deliver high-quality, user-centric products. 
  • Develop and maintain a data-driven product roadmap that reflects the company’s strategic direction, market opportunities, and priorities of the company. 
  • Conduct internal and market analysis to identify opportunities and inform product decisions. 
  • Stay on top of healthcare trends, regulatory changes, and emerging technologies to identify opportunities for innovation and ensure that our products remain competitive and compliant. 
  • Define, prioritize, and document product features and requirements, creating detailed Agile stories, acceptance criteria, and clear product specifications, while ensuring flexibility to adapt as new insights and opportunities emerge in the healthcare space.   
  • Work closely with development teams to ensure timely and accurate delivery of product features, managing risks and dependencies, and maintaining a focus on improving user experience and healthcare outcomes.   
  • Monitor product performance and user feedback to drive continuous improvement and innovation, using data, market analysis, and user insights to continuously iterate and improve products, driving innovation based on evolving customer needs.   
  • Communicate product vision, strategy, and progress to stakeholders at all levels of the organization. 
  • Foster a culture of curiosity by encouraging continuous learning within the team by actively seeking out new ideas, trends, and best practices in the healthcare industry.   

Knowledge, Skills and Abilities: 

  • In-depth understanding of the Software Development Lifecycle (SDLC). 
  • Excellent analytical, problem-solving, and decision-making skills. 
  • Strong communication and interpersonal skills, with the ability to collaborate effectively with diverse teams. 
  • Ability to manage multiple projects and priorities in a fast-paced environment. 
  • Strong analytical skills including the ability to gather and interpret data, understand customer needs, and drive decision-making based on insights. 
  • A demonstrated natural curiosity for healthcare, technology, and market trends, with a desire to continuously learn and adapt to the evolving landscape of the industry.   

Required Education and Experience:  

  • 5+ years of experience as a Product Manager with a focus on technology solutions in the US healthcare sector – preferably healthcare analytics, business intelligence, or data-driven products. 
  • Bachelor’s degree in a related field. 
  • In-depth understanding of the US healthcare system, including healthcare providers, payers, regulations and emerging trends.  
  • Strong background in business intelligence solutions and data analytics. 
  • Proficiency in Agile methodology and experience in generating Agile stories and detailed requirements. 

Preferred Qualifications: 

  • Experience with Agile project management tools (e.g., Jira, Trello). 
  • Experience working within or with Payor organizations 
  • Knowledge of healthcare industry trends and emerging technologies. 

Location: Fully remote within the US (Must be located in the US) 

Salary: $145,000 - $160,000 plus bonus, equity, 401k match, unlimited PTO and medical/dental/vision insurance

What you need to know about the Seattle Tech Scene

Home to tech titans like Microsoft and Amazon, Seattle punches far above its weight in innovation. But its surrounding mountains, sprinkled with world-famous hiking trails and climbing routes, make the city a destination for outdoorsy types as well. Established as a logging town before shifting to shipbuilding and logistics, the Emerald City is now known for its contributions to aerospace, software, biotech and cloud computing. And its status as a thriving tech ecosystem is attracting out-of-town companies looking to establish new tech and engineering hubs.

Key Facts About Seattle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 287,000; 13%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Amazon, Microsoft, Meta, Google
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, cloud computing, software, biotechnology, game development
  • Funding Landscape: $3.1 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Madrona, Fuse, Tola, Maveron
  • Research Centers and Universities: University of Washington, Seattle University, Seattle Pacific University, Allen Institute for Brain Science, Bill & Melinda Gates Foundation, Seattle Children’s Research Institute
